Output 0e80ef9513f75f41b4670f6c98d414032d3973a60df9768c4fd3b01ad2876719:66

value
13096862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f5579ab278e07b3d80f9ed1ab19be6405a4d9e5 OP_EQUAL
address
37TttZ8bKUhxkCtVewBty3Ws9YBTKga1eJ
transaction
0e80ef9513f75f41b4670f6c98d414032d3973a60df9768c4fd3b01ad2876719
confirmations
328216
spent
true